Welcome Note from our Managing Director

We are thrilled to welcome you to the NEC for this exciting gathering of energy-focused events: The Distributed Energy Show (DES) and The Energy Storage Show (ESS), now united under the umbrella of Energy Technology Live (ETL). While two of these brands are making their debut this year, DES is now in its fourth edition, following remarkable growth since its launch in December 2021. Originally held at the Telford International Centre, an excellent home for its early years, the event has now moved to the UK’s leading exhibition venue to accommodate the rapid expansion of this dynamic industry. By bringing these shows together under the ETL banner, our goal is to create the UK’s most comprehensive showcase of energy technologies—highlighting solutions that define the energy system of the future: flexible, renewable, and decentralised. Here, you will discover a wide array of technologies and services, with some of the energy sector’s most prominent organisations exhibiting alongside innovative start-ups—all sharing a common mission: to help energy users and industry leaders optimise energy use while advancing sustainability and efficiency goals. Each corner of the hall features a conference theatre, carefully curated to provide practical insights, industry trends, and a forward-looking perspective on the challenges and opportunities shaping the future of energy and sustainability. Inside this show guide, you’ll find details about our exhibitors, a product directory, and the conference agenda for each theatre. The Association for Decentralised Energy (ADE) is the UK’s leading trade association for decentralised energy, advocating for its two missions: Decarbonising British Heat and Empowering Energy Demand . The ADE represents more than 160 organisations from across the energy sector, working across a broad range of technologies. Empowering Energy Demand strives to make sure Great Britain embraces the valueof a decarbonised, demand-led system , creating a future where households, businesses and industry are properly rewarded. About VPS Power With over 40 years of expertise, VPS Power stands as a premier independent testing and advisory service provider to the electrical industry. We support key industry sectors including power generation, renewables, transmission & distribution network operators, manufacturing industries, OEMs, engineering installation, maintenance, and purification companies. Our mission is to help clients achieve sustainable operations, heighten asset protection, improve preventative maintenance performance, and attain compliance with environmental and legislative standards. Our Commitment to Reliability and Sustainability As the industry transitions to electrification and strives towards net zero, VPS Power understands the critical importance of asset reliability. Our bespoke Transformer Oil Testing service is designed to prevent electrical asset failures, ensuring a consistent electricity supply for network providers and customers, whilst safeguarding the environment and public safety. Certifications and Affiliations VPS Power is proudly certified to ISO 14001, ISO 45001, ISO 9001, and ISO 17025 standards. We are a part of the Veritas Petroleum Services Group.
